Yellow green vs RAL 230-3
Where Yellow green belongs to RAL Classic's range, RAL 230-3 is a RAL Effect color. These are both green-yellows, so the question isn't which hue to choose — it's where within green-yellow to land. RAL 230-3 (LRV 31) reflects noticeably more light than Yellow green (LRV 28), a difference of 3 points that becomes especially apparent in rooms with limited natural light. With a ΔE of 12.0, the contrast is hard to miss. These aren't variations on a theme — they're two different answers to the same question.
